Linstead Ln - streets of North Bellmore (New York).
Explore "Linstead Ln" on the map of North Bellmore in street view mode
Click on the buttons below to display the map of Linstead Ln, North Bellmore, United States
Search street by name:
Tags:
Linstead Ln on the map of North Bellmore,
North Bellmore satellite view, North Bellmore street view.